[java] Create intermediate folders if one doesn't exist

I am trying to create a folder for each username a user logs in as. Currently I have

private String destination = "C:/Users/Richard/printing~subversion/fileupload/web/WEB-INF/uploaded/"; // main location for uploads
File theFile = new File(destination + username); // will create a sub folder for each user 

but the File theFile bit does not create a new folder for the username. How would I do this ?

I have tried

private String destination;

public void File() 
{
    destination = "C:/Users/Richard/printing~subversion/fileupload/web/WEB-INF/uploaded/"; // main location for uploads
    File theFile = new File(destination + username); // will create a sub folder for each user (currently does not work, below hopefully is a solution) 
    theFile.mkdirs();
}

but I need to use the destination later on in the program, how would I do that?

The answer is


A nice Java 7+ answer from Benoit Blanchon can be found here:

With Java 7, you can use Files.createDirectories().

For instance:

Files.createDirectories(Paths.get("/path/to/directory"));

Use this code spinet for create intermediate folders if one doesn't exist while creating/editing file:

File outFile = new File("/dir1/dir2/dir3/test.file");
outFile.getParentFile().mkdirs();
outFile.createNewFile();
